Поделиться через


ADOAdapter2.Command Свойство

Определение

Возвращает или задает текст командной строки SQL для ADOAdapterObject объекта .

public:
 property System::String ^ Command { System::String ^ get(); void set(System::String ^ value); };
public string Command { get; set; }
member this.Command : string with get, set
Public Property Command As String

Значение свойства

Реализации

Примеры

В следующем примере свойство Command объекта ADOAdapter используется для запроса таблицы Employees базы данных Northwind через дополнительный источник данных "Employees". Значение EmployeeID возвращаемой записи соответствует значению my:field2 узла. В этом примере требуется my:field2 в main источник данных и привязка к текстовому поле в представлении, которое содержит кнопку для вызова следующего кода:

// retrieve the Employees Adapter from the DataAdapters collection
ADOAdapter employeesDA = (ADOAdapter)thisXDocument.DataAdapters["Employees"];
// get employee’s ID from the main DOM
string employeeID = thisXDocument.DOM.selectSingleNode("//my:field2").text;
// Change the ADOAdapter’s command to retrieve the record of the Employee’s ID entered
// by the user
employeesDA.<span class="label">Command </span>= "select * from Employees where EmployeeID = " + employeeID;
// get DataObject from the DataObjects collection and call Query to refresh
// the data object
DataObject employeesDO = thisXDocument.DataObjects["Employees"];
employeesDO.Query();

Комментарии

Свойство Command объекта ADOAdapter содержит текст команды SQL, используемый адаптером данных ADO для отправки данных на внешний источник данных ActiveX Data Objects/OLEDB и получения данных из него.

Примечание. Объект ADOAdapter ограничен работой только с базами данных Microsoft SQL Server и Microsoft Access.

Важно! Доступ к этому члену можно получить только с помощью форм, работающих в том же домене, что и открытая форма, или с помощью форм, которым предоставлены междоменные разрешения.

Применяется к